Liverpool's Kolo Toure puts Arsenal victory behind him to focus on Fulham

Kolo Toure insists that Liverpool have put their win over Arsenal behind them as they focus on taking on Fulham at Craven Cottage.

Liverpool defender Kolo Toure has insisted that he and his teammates have put their stunning victory over Arsenal behind them in order to focus on Fulham.

The Merseyside outfit will face the London club at Craven Cottage this evening following last weekend's 5-1 win over the Gunners.

"We just take it game by game," Toure told the club's official website. "What we did against Arsenal is finished now, the next game is the most important for us and we will focus on that. As a team we are going to work hard and try to get the three points.

"We just need to keep the focus because this is another really challenging game and they are fighting to avoid relegation right now."

The Reds are currently fourth in the Premier League table.
